Nirajan AcharyaDo you know how genetic algorithm works ?A genetic algorithm is a metaheuristic inspired by the process of natural selection. It involves the evolution of a population of…Jun 121Jun 121
Nirajan AcharyaWhich loss functions are (typically) best suited for specific ML algorithmsMachine learning algorithms serve as the cornerstone of artificial intelligence systems, enabling computers to learn from data and make…Apr 1Apr 1
Nirajan AcharyaDo you really think Hypertuning improve model’s accuracy ?In the world of machine learning, where models learn from data, the quest for accuracy is paramount. But what if there’s a hidden key that…Mar 21Mar 21
Nirajan AcharyaBalancing Act: A Guide to Undersampling for Improved Machine Learning PerformanceUnder-sampling is a technique used to address the issue of class imbalance in datasets. Class imbalance occurs when one class (the minority…Mar 6Mar 6
Nirajan AcharyaHow to Build Rock-Solid Machine Learning Models: Strategies for Stability and GeneralizationDiscover the keys to building machine learning models that stand the test of time. In this blog, we explore essential strategies for…Feb 17Feb 17
Nirajan AcharyaUnderstanding Precision, Recall, F1-score, and Support in Machine Learning EvaluationWhen it comes to evaluating the performance of machine learning models, accuracy is just the tip of the iceberg. In classification tasks…Feb 15Feb 15
Nirajan AcharyaUnderstanding Outlier Removal Using Interquartile Range (IQR)Outliers, those pesky data points that don’t seem to conform to the norm, can wreak havoc on statistical analyses and machine learning…Feb 13Feb 13
Nirajan AcharyainPython in Plain EnglishUnlocking the Power of SEO: A Transformational Fusion of AI and PythonIn the world of SEO, the fusion of ChatGPT and Python is creating quite the buzz. Whether you’re eagerly embracing the possibilities…Sep 29, 2023Sep 29, 2023
Nirajan AcharyaWhy Is It Called “Logistic Regression” and Not “Logistic Classification”?Logistic Regression, despite its name, is a widely used machine learning algorithm for binary classification tasks. The name can be…Sep 26, 20232Sep 26, 20232
Nirajan AcharyainPython in Plain EnglishThree-Dimensional Plotting Using MatplotlibTo generate a three-dimensional graph, you need to configure the projection parameter using the ‘3d’ keyword. It’s important to keep in…Sep 25, 2023Sep 25, 2023